Type
ORACLE
Validation date
2024-03-28 18:29: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0359,
    "usd": 0.03875
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001BEB26F0682129625810A13E9118CDC6C027B6D8F3B051F4A80581FEE41D9F383

Previous signature

D8D6E1B03B7C34A7844533DDEBB14517B9EDFC05046BD1A5AC107201A522AB0BC585AE74A698AF2EBA835B221404184CFBCCD86B35E5670EACB25978401E8805

Origin signature

3046022100D3605FC6A8F397F657CA09880A8C703C5446249C0B39BBE0D0C6BEB31BFBF495022100B430809B365218B2AAF69518BDDC4A9FDF3BB86A147EA447EBF04480A8BB19E6

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

00FE8290751388E903D5A58042F33F3DA8B2F6343DB8792D3F67907ED0929775C9

Coordinator signature

35A3C6CBDD536C9506FF635CE7549E0D840D24576EEC98A44528CDBC195782BAA488AC381D5BCD42B5D00C2DF73B635AF9770660105B594C200C3109369BC908

Validator #1 public key

0001E490741F025D9C59E4D85ABA60E6D8018FBB7F38EDC33D2552AAB0A90E93ACA6

Validator #1 signature

5666D41E19462B858DA14E50E106B2B58B1B6703C7FE9FF7942E4A495C6CF29454B7B1A8173264FA72189CD0B8DAB5FF11D8BB11703987707124478326E84703

Validator #2 public key

0001FE0F759D8C583CB8351DB3F1BA2F045F114F0BA7600CCEC9048E48CC3E5FE4AF

Validator #2 signature

2336FD528B64B891BBC89E9C169BDB01EBB54F5087E661D47639747A2E48AC9F608C8E867E940730505D038C057E2DE81BA3BCC7A0E9719CDB01384DCC6C730D